Key Topics to Revise

1

Background and Historical Context

  • Post-World War II era (1950s) marked the beginning of new social movements
  • Decolonization of countries like India, China, Indonesia, Nigeria, and Egypt created new political awareness
  • Economic growth and prosperity led to demands for equal rights by previously marginalized groups
2

American Civil Rights Movement (1960s)

  • Fought for equal treatment of African Americans and against racial segregation
  • Key issues: segregation in schools, buses, public places; discrimination in employment, housing, voting
  • Montgomery Bus Boycott (1956) led by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. successfully ended bus segregation
3

Human Rights Movements in USSR

  • USSR had authoritarian government with no free elections, press, or movement
  • Movements emerged in Hungary, Czechoslovakia, Poland for freedom from USSR control
  • Leaders like Alexander Solzhenitsyn (writer) and Andrei Sakharov (scientist) led human rights movements
4

Anti-Nuclear and Anti-War Movements (1970s-1980s)

  • Emerged after horrors of Hiroshima and Nagasaki nuclear bombings (1945)
  • Cold War arms race between USA and USSR created global fear
  • Vietnam War (1964-1975): 8-30 lakh Vietnamese casualties, USA used chemical weapons
